Abstract

This invention provides a carbon capture and phosphorus removal apparatus and a carbon capture and phosphorus removal method for wastewater treatment. [Solution] The apparatus comprises a wastewater tank 1, an SBR reactor 2 communicating with the wastewater tank, a denitrification reactor 3 communicating with a drain pipe in the middle of the SBR reactor, and an anaerobic digester 4 communicating with a sludge discharge pipe at the bottom of the SBR reactor. A biochar sludge removal device 6 is provided on the anaerobic digester side. The method includes the steps of S1, water injection and stirring, S2, SBR treatment, S3, circulation, S4, sludge fermentation, and S5, magnetic biochar recovery. In this invention, magnetic biochar is introduced into a high-load contact-stabilized SBR reactor to synchronously promote the adsorption of organic carbon and phosphorus in the wastewater, further enhancing the capture effect of dissolved organic matter, promoting the adsorption of organic carbon and phosphorus in the wastewater, and ensuring a stable and efficient carbon capture and phosphorus removal effect.

Background Art

[0002] In the prior art, the activated sludge method is mainly adopted for sewage treatment, but the conventional activated sludge method has problems such as high energy consumption and high carbon emissions. The organic carbon in urban wastewater is rich in chemical energy, and efficiently capturing the organic carbon in the influent water is one of the important measures to achieve the low-carbon operation of wastewater plants. For the technology of capturing organic carbon in wastewater, there are mainly chemical enhanced primary treatment, high-load membrane separation technology, high-load activated sludge method, etc. Although the above technologies can achieve high organic carbon capture efficiency, they rely on a large amount of flocculant injection and high investment costs, resulting in high operating costs and being difficult to widely popularize and apply. Biochar is an ideal adsorbent for soluble organic matter. However, it is difficult to separate biochar from water. Also, introducing magnetic Fe3O4 into the biochar matrix to prepare magnetic biochar is an effective method to solve this problem. Fe3O4 can form a complex with phosphate and enhance the phosphorus removal effect. Therefore, exploring the technology for enhancing carbon capture of wastewater in the high-load activated sludge method based on magnetic biochar can provide support for the optimal control and popularization of the process. At present, there is still a need for further research on the combined use of magnetic biochar and high-load activated sludge in wastewater treatment. The present invention further provides a carbon capture and phosphorus removal method based on the above carbon capture and phosphorus removal device. This method includes the following steps: ​​S1. Water injection and stirring: Inject sewage into the sewage tank, uniformly stir it with the first stirrer, and then transport the sewage to the SBR reactor through the sewage pipe and, S2. SBR treatment: The operation modes of the SBR reactor include a contact stage, a sedimentation stage, a drainage stage, and a stabilization stage including Contact stage: Put magnetic biochar into the SBR reactor by a dozer, and the input amount of the magnetic biochar is 100 - 500 mg / L. After input, turn on the second stirrer for stirring, and the rotation speed is 100 - 150 rpm, stir for 10 - 15 min Sedimentation stage: Turn off the second stirrer, energize the electromagnet to form an electromagnetic field, and under the action of the electromagnetic field, promote the sedimentation of magnetic biochar and sludge. The energization time is 10 - 30 min and is Drainage stage: Open the drain pump, transport the sewage in the SBR reactor to the denitrification reaction tank through the drain pipe, perform denitrification treatment on the sewage entering the denitrification reaction tank in the denitrification reaction tank, and when the sewage in the SBR reactor is drained to half of the water level, close the drain pump and is Stabilization stage: Open the air pump, aerate the sewage and sludge in the SBR reactor through the aeration pipe, continuously aerate for 4 0 - 50 min, control the solubility to 1.5 - 2 mg / L, and at the same time of aeration, turn on the second stir rer for stirring. The rotation speed of the second stirrer is 60 - 150 rpm. Then open the sludge discharge pump and discharge 1 / 4 - 1 / 3 of the sludge in the SBR reactor to the anaerobic digestion tank through the sludge discharge pipe and In the SBR reactor, the biochar in the magnetic biochar plays a role in removing organic carbon in the sewage. The specific mechanism is that during the wastewater treatment process, a biofilm is formed on the surface of the biochar, and a synergistic effect of the adsorption of activated carbon and the oxidation and decomposition of organic carbon by microorganisms occurs and the magnetic powder in the magnetic biochar plays a role in removing phosphorus. The specific mechanism is Fe ​ 3O4 forms a complex with phosphate, thereby enhancing the phosphorus removal effect. In the denitrification reactor, it is also necessary to denitrify the wastewater from which organic carbon and phosphorus have been removed. The basic mechanism is that sludge is loaded onto a floating packing material assembly in a denitrification reactor and bio A film is formed, and as wastewater passes through the biofilm, microorganisms perform actions such as adsorption and decomposition. The purpose is to decompose nitrogen elements in wastewater into gaseous nitrogen through use, thereby achieving the objective of denitrification. S3, Circulation: Repeat S1 and S2 to treat the next batch of wastewater. S4. Sludge fermentation: Adjust the internal temperature of the anaerobic digester to 37±0.2℃ and stir with the third agitator. The speed is 100-120 rpm, and fermentation takes place for 20-25 days to obtain the remaining sludge, and biogas Biogas from inside the anaerobic digester is collected via a discharge pipe, and then the remaining sludge is removed by a desludge processing unit. Discharge into the container. In an anaerobic digester, the remaining sludge is reused to produce biogas through resource recovery. The specific mechanism involves the anaerobic digestion of sludge, which converts organic matter in the sludge into biogas. Anaerobic digestion involves conversion, including hydrolysis, oxidation, hydrogen production, acetic acid production, and methane production. It includes the following four stages: S5, Magnetic biochar recovery: The remaining sludge is passed through the main body of the desludge removal device, water is added to the main body of the device, water The amount added is 3 to 4 times the weight of the sludge, and the ultrasonic generator inside the warehouse is opened, generating ultrasonic waves. The ultrasonic output of the device is adjusted to 800-1200W to perform ultrasonic treatment, and the first motor is operated simultaneously. The opening and the rotation shaft is rotated by the first motor, guiding the magnetic biocarbon onto the plate. It is attached to the underside of the torch and controls one of the second motors every 5 minutes to control the corresponding hydraulic telescopic rod. The guide plate is moved upwards to the height of the reflux tank by extending and retracting the guide plate, and the axis of rotation is the guide plate As the guide plate rotates, the scraper removes magnetic biocarbon that has adhered to the underside of the guide plate. The material is scraped off and dropped into the reflux tank, and the magnetic biochar recovered in the reflux tank is then transferred through the reflux pipe. Transported to a bulldozer for reuse, The method for preparing the magnetic biochar is as follows: biomass raw material and stainless steel After mixing steel balls in a mass ratio of 1:100 and loading them into a stainless steel polishing tank for polishing, 2 The material is passed through a 00-mesh sieve to obtain biomass powder, and the diameter of the stainless steel spheres is 3 mm. The biomass powder and magnetic powder are mixed in a mass ratio of 1:2 to 4 and then milled in a planetary ball mill. Loaded into the ball mill, the planetary ball mill rotates at a speed of 300-400 rpm for 10 After operating for approximately 12 hours, remove and wash three times alternately with ultrapure water and ethanol, then heat at 60-70°C. After drying, magnetic biochar is obtained. The aforementioned biomass raw material is one of the following: coconut shells, wood chips, or rice husk biochar. The magnetic powder is Fe3O4 powder, and the diameter of the magnetic powder is less than 2 mm. [Effects of the Invention]

[0004] The present invention has the following beneficial effects. (1) The present invention involves introducing magnetic biochar into a high-load contact-stabilized SBR reactor, and magnetic biochar It not only functions as a carrier for microbial adhesion, but also forms complexes with phosphorus, and organic carbon in wastewater. This synchronously promotes phosphorus adsorption and, under constant stirring action, ensures a uniform distribution of the flow field in the reaction flow pattern. This can achieve the desired effect, increasing the contact efficiency between wastewater, sludge, and magnetic biochar, and improving dissolution. It further enhances the capture effect of organic matter, promotes the adsorption of organic carbon and phosphorus in wastewater, and provides stable and At the same time, the magnetic material in magnetic biochar ensures efficient carbon scavenging and phosphorus removal, while also providing microorganisms. It also exhibits a magnetic effect, adsorbing organic carbon and phosphorus in wastewater and subsequently aiding in anaerobic digestion of sludge. This can further improve the efficiency of energy resource recovery. (2) The apparatus of the present invention employs an external electromagnet, and when the SBR reactor operates to the sedimentation stage, By energizing the electromagnets, an electromagnetic field is created, promoting the rapid settling of magnetic biochar into biochar sludge. The adsorption action enables the rapid and synchronous settlement of sludge, improving sludge settlement efficiency, and consequently This achieves highly efficient cutoff of particulate and colloidal organic carbon, shortening the hydraulic holding time and reducing the reaction This can significantly improve the impact load resistance capacity of the equipment. (3) The present invention provides an anaerobic digestion treatment for a mixture of discharged magnetic biochar and sludge. This allows for a significant improvement in biogas yield and a reduction in the startup time of the anaerobic digester. Therefore, the methane content in biogas increases, improving the efficiency of wastewater energy conversion and resource utilization. Furthermore, magnetic biochar after anaerobic digestion can be easily washed and reused, and is equipped with a bi The charcoal sludge removal device has a simple structure, is easy to operate, and operates stably, ultimately removing organic matter from wastewater. It effectively improves carbon capture efficiency while also having a good removal effect on phosphorus, and stains It has a fast mudset rate, low energy and material consumption, and is stable, highly efficient, and low energy consumption.
